04/07/08: Record flight in Norway and long XC flights in Switzerland
Arne Kristian Boiesen and Daniel Bjørkås push the limits to a new dimension in Norway, and Thomas Koster makes two flights of over 250 km. On July 3rd the Norwegian (and Scandinavian) XC record was well and truly shattered. Arne Kristian Boiesen (OMEGA 7) and Daniel Bjørkås (Boomerang 5) flew from Trysil near the Swedish border respectively 210 km as far as Skjåk (Arne), and 235.6 km to Bjorli (Daniel) in about 7 hours. This new paraglider record exceeds the current delta figure by 30 km, and is 80 km farther than the Frode Halse’s previous record (OMEGA 7).
